Hardware The PIXCI® D is a simple interface - a plug-and-play board with no jumpers or adjustments. It is factory optimized to support one particular camera. Once you insert the board into your computer, install the software, and connect the cable, your system is ready to capture images! The PIXCI® D provides 16 bit counters to program the EXSYNC and PRIN signals for DALSA cameras. The board can be used for asynchronous capture or extended integration. The PIXCI® D is a high bandwidth interface controlled by the camera's pixel clock for "data in", and by the computer's PCI chip set for "data out". Only the PCI bandwidth constrains the use of multiple cameras. The PCI bus can transfer data at rates up to 132 megabytes per second in burst mode, or up to 100 megabytes per second sustained. A single PIXCI® D can interface to either 1, 2, 3, or 4 single channel 8 bit cameras, allowing simultaneous video rate acquisition to PC memory. Boards are also available for either 1 or 2 dual channel cameras, and for 1 quad channel camera. Multiple PIXCI® D imaging boards can be installed in a single computer. "C" Function Library EPIX software is designed for engineered imaging applications requiring control of specific DALSA camera signals. Software control is provided for the PRIN signal (exposure) and the EXSYNC signal (line rate or frame rate). EPIX software specializes in sequence capture and display with the ability to fill all of the available PC memory. Sequences from DALSA area scan cameras can be captured at maximum video rate - which includes capture from the CA-D1-0064A at 2,900 fps! Sequences from DALSA line scan cameras are captured into user-defined 2D buffers without loss of a single line! Line scan images can be viewed, processed, and analyzed exactly like area scan images.
